Can You Cut PVC with a Circular Saw? The Short Answer and What You Need to Know

Let’s get straight to it: Yes, you absolutely can cut PVC with a circular saw. In fact, for larger PVC pipes or sheets, a circular saw can be one of the most efficient tools available, offering speed and the ability to make long, straight cuts that other tools struggle with. However, it’s not as simple as just grabbing your saw and going for it. Special considerations are crucial for safety and achieving quality results.

The key difference lies in how PVC responds to heat and friction. Unlike wood, which creates sawdust, PVC can melt and gum up your blade if not cut correctly. This can lead to rough edges, dangerous kickbacks, and even damage to your saw. But with the right approach, your circular saw becomes a powerful asset for PVC projects.

When to Choose Other Tools for PVC

Despite its advantages, a circular saw isn’t always the best tool for every PVC job. Consider these alternatives:

  • PVC Pipe Cutters: Ideal for small to medium diameter pipes (up to 2 inches), offering very clean, burr-free cuts with minimal effort.
  • Hacksaw: A versatile hand tool for smaller, infrequent cuts, especially in tight spaces where a power tool isn’t practical.
  • Miter Saw: Excellent for precise, repeatable angled cuts on PVC pipes, similar to how it handles wood trim.
  • Jigsaw: Useful for intricate or curved cuts on PVC sheets, though it can leave rougher edges.

For quick, clean, small diameter cuts, a dedicated PVC cutter is often superior. But for larger, straighter cuts, the circular saw shines.

Securing Your PVC Material

This is perhaps the most critical safety step after PPE. Unsecured material is a recipe for disaster.

  • Use Clamps: Secure the PVC pipe or sheet firmly to your workbench using C-clamps or quick-release clamps. It should not move, even slightly, during the cut.
  • Support the Offcut: Ensure both sides of your cut are supported. If the offcut piece drops suddenly, it can pinch the blade, causing kickback or a jagged finish. Use saw horses or additional clamps to support longer pieces.
  • Avoid Hand-Holding: Never hold the PVC with your hand while cutting with a circular saw. It’s too dangerous.

Choosing the Right Blade: Key to Clean Cuts and Safety

The blade you choose is the single most important factor in successfully cutting PVC with a circular saw. Using the wrong blade can lead to melted plastic, rough edges, blade damage, and increased risk of kickback. This section is a crucial part of any “can you cut PVC with a circular saw guide.”

Understanding Blade Types for PVC

Forget your aggressive wood-ripping blades. PVC requires a different approach:

  • Fine-Tooth Blades: Look for a blade with a high tooth count (60-80 teeth for a 7-1/4 inch blade). More teeth mean smaller bites into the material, reducing friction and heat buildup, which helps prevent melting.
  • Carbide-Tipped Blades: These blades stay sharper longer and are more resistant to the abrasive nature of PVC. They also glide through the material more smoothly.
  • Plastic-Specific Blades: Some manufacturers offer blades specifically designed for cutting plastics. These often have unique tooth geometries that excel at shearing plastic without excessive heat. If you frequently cut PVC, investing in one is a smart move.
  • Avoid Aggressive Wood Blades: Blades with large, widely spaced teeth are designed to aggressively remove wood fibers. On PVC, these teeth will grab, tear, and melt the plastic, creating a mess and a dangerous situation.

A general-purpose plywood blade with a high tooth count can work in a pinch, but a dedicated fine-tooth or plastic blade is always preferable.

RPM Considerations for PVC

While you can’t typically adjust the RPM on a standard circular saw, understanding the principle is key to your cutting technique:

  • Lower RPM is Better: High blade speed generates more friction and heat. When cutting PVC, you want to minimize heat.
  • Slow and Steady Feed Rate: Since you can’t lower the saw’s RPM, compensate by using a slower, more controlled feed rate. This allows the blade to cleanly shear the plastic rather than melt it.

Setting Up Your Saw Correctly

Proper saw adjustment is crucial for both safety and cut quality.

  1. Adjust Blade Depth: Set the blade depth so that it extends just about 1/4 inch to 1/2 inch below the material you are cutting. Too much blade exposed increases kickback risk and makes the saw harder to control.
  2. Check Blade Angle: Ensure your saw’s base plate is set to 90 degrees for a straight cut. If you need an angled cut, adjust it accordingly, but ensure it’s locked securely.
  3. Test Cut (Optional but Recommended): If you have a scrap piece of the same PVC, make a test cut to check your blade, depth, and technique before cutting your main piece.

The Cutting Technique: Smooth and Steady

This is where finesse comes into play. The goal is to cut through the PVC without melting it.

  1. Position Yourself: Stand in a balanced stance, with your body slightly to the side of the saw, not directly behind it. This is safer in case of kickback.
  2. Start the Saw: Bring the blade up to full speed *before* it touches the PVC.
  3. Engage the Material: Gently lower the spinning blade into the PVC. Do not force it.
  4. Maintain a Steady Feed Rate: Push the saw through the PVC at a slow, consistent pace. The saw should do the work. If you push too fast, you risk chipping. Too slow, and you increase heat buildup and melting. You’ll hear and feel the saw cutting smoothly.
  5. Keep the Saw Moving: Do not pause or stop the blade mid-cut. This is when melting and fusing are most likely to occur.
  6. Support the Saw: Keep the saw’s base plate flat against the material for stability and a straight cut. For long cuts on sheets, use a straight edge or guide. For pipes, ensure the pipe is well-clamped and supported.
  7. Complete the Cut: Follow through completely. Once the cut is finished, release the trigger and wait for the blade to stop spinning before lifting the saw from the material.

Post-Cut Finishing: Deburring and Smoothing

Even with the best technique, PVC often leaves a slight burr (rough edge) after cutting.

  • Deburr Immediately: Use a utility knife, a deburring tool, or a piece of sandpaper (120-220 grit) to quickly remove any burrs from both the inside and outside edges of the cut.
  • Smooth Edges: If the project requires perfectly smooth edges, a light sanding with fine-grit sandpaper (220-400 grit) will achieve this.

Troubleshooting Common Problems When Cutting PVC with a Circular Saw

Even with the right setup, you might encounter some hiccups. Knowing how to address “common problems with can you cut PVC with a circular saw” will save you time and frustration.

Melting and Fusing

This is the most frequent complaint when cutting PVC, resulting in sticky, gummed-up blades and rough, fused edges.

  • Cause: Excessive heat from friction, usually due to a dull blade, the wrong blade type, or too slow a feed rate.
  • Solution:
    • Check Your Blade: Ensure you are using a sharp, fine-tooth, carbide-tipped blade. Replace dull blades.
    • Increase Feed Rate (Slightly): While a slow feed is good, *too slow* can allow heat to build up. Find a steady pace where the blade cuts cleanly without bogging down.
    • Reduce RPM (If Possible): If your saw has variable speed, use a lower setting. If not, rely on blade choice and feed rate.
    • Clean the Blade: If the blade is gummed up, clean it with a blade cleaner or a solvent designed for plastics (always test on a scrap first).

Chipping and Cracking

This often happens with thinner PVC sheets or when the material isn’t adequately supported.

  • Cause: Insufficient support, aggressive blade, or too fast a feed rate.
  • Solution:
    • Improve Support: Ensure the PVC is firmly clamped and supported directly under the cut line. Use sacrificial boards underneath if cutting sheets.
    • Use the Right Blade: A fine-tooth blade designed for plastics will minimize chipping.
    • Slow Down Your Feed Rate: A slower, more controlled pass reduces stress on the material.
    • Score the Cut Line: For very thin or brittle PVC, lightly score the cut line with a utility knife before cutting with the saw.

Uneven or Crooked Cuts

A straight cut is essential for most projects. Crooked cuts are usually due to user error or poor setup.

  • Cause: Inadequate clamping, unsteady hand, or not using a guide.
  • Solution:
    • Clamp Firmly: Re-emphasize securing the PVC properly. It should not shift at all.
    • Use a Straight Edge/Guide: For long, straight cuts, clamp a straight edge (like a level or a factory edge of plywood) to your material and run the saw’s base plate along it. This is one of the best “can you cut PVC with a circular saw tips” for accuracy.
    • Maintain a Consistent Stance: Keep your body balanced and your eyes on the cut line.
    • Check Blade Squareness: Ensure your saw’s base plate is set to a true 90 degrees.

Proper PVC Waste Disposal

PVC is a plastic, and it’s not always accepted in standard recycling bins. Knowing how to handle it ensures “eco-friendly can you cut PVC with a circular saw” practices.

  • Check Local Recycling: Contact your local waste management facility or recycling center. Some facilities have specific programs for hard plastics or construction waste.
  • Specialized Recycling Programs: For larger quantities, inquire if there are industrial or specialized plastic recycling programs in your area.
  • Avoid Burning: Never burn PVC. It releases toxic fumes that are harmful to human health and the environment.
  • Landfill as Last Resort: If recycling isn’t an option, dispose of PVC waste responsibly in a landfill according to local regulations.

Storing PVC Materials

Proper storage prolongs the life of your PVC and ensures it’s ready for your next project.

  • Store Flat and Supported: Long lengths of PVC pipe or sheets can warp if stored improperly. Store them horizontally on a flat surface or on supports to prevent sagging.
  • Keep Out of Direct Sunlight: UV rays can degrade PVC over time, making it brittle. Store PVC in a shaded area or indoors.
  • Protect from Extreme Temperatures: While PVC is quite durable, extreme heat can soften it, and extreme cold can make it more brittle and prone to cracking.

Long-Term Project Considerations

Think beyond the initial cut for projects involving PVC.

  • UV Exposure: If your PVC project will be outdoors, consider using UV-resistant PVC or painting it with UV-protective paint to extend its lifespan.
  • Expansion and Contraction: PVC expands and contracts with temperature changes. Factor this into your design, especially for long runs of pipe or large panels, to prevent buckling or stress.
  • Adhesives and Joining: Use appropriate PVC cement and primer for strong, leak-proof joints. Ensure surfaces are clean and free of dust from cutting.

Frequently Asked Questions About Cutting PVC with a Circular Saw

Can I use a regular wood blade to cut PVC?

While you *can* technically use a regular wood blade, it’s strongly advised against. Aggressive wood blades with fewer, larger teeth tend to generate too much heat, leading to melting, gumming, rough cuts, and increased risk of kickback. Always opt for a fine-tooth, carbide-tipped blade (60-80 teeth) designed for plastics or plywood for best results.

What’s the best way to prevent PVC from melting during the cut?

Preventing melting comes down to reducing friction and heat. Use a sharp, fine-tooth blade, maintain a consistent and steady (but not too slow) feed rate, and ensure the blade is clean. If your saw has variable speed, use a lower RPM. Avoid stopping the blade mid-cut, as this allows heat to concentrate.

Do I need to wear a respirator when cutting PVC?

Yes, absolutely. Cutting PVC generates fine plastic dust, which can be irritating to your respiratory system. Always wear a good quality dust mask (N95 or better) or a respirator, especially when working in enclosed spaces. Ensure good ventilation in your work area.

How do I get a perfectly straight cut on a long PVC pipe?

For perfectly straight cuts on long PVC pipes or sheets, use a clamped straight edge or guide. Securely clamp the PVC to your workbench, then clamp a piece of straight wood or a metal ruler parallel to your cut line, ensuring the saw’s base plate can ride smoothly along it. This acts as a fence for your circular saw, guaranteeing a straight path.

Is cutting PVC dust harmful?

PVC dust can be an irritant to the eyes, skin, and respiratory tract. While occasional exposure might not cause severe issues, prolonged or frequent inhalation should be avoided. Always use appropriate PPE, including eye protection and a respirator, and ensure good ventilation to minimize exposure.
